num_dims < 3 peferred in general. This likely does not affect things, but num_dims is a case-optimization parameter, and therefore the compiler can optimize this away if you make it a check on num_dims.

Missing regression coverage. This PR adds the hemisphere-shell execution path but removes the local example and adds no test fixture. The existing particle-cloud case is box-only, so CI never executes
geometry = 2. Please add a small deterministic 2D or 3D case that checks generated particle positions for shell/plane clearance and non-overlap. -
Documentation was not updated.
docs/documentation/case.mddoes not documentgeometry,shell_inner_radius, orshell_outer_radius, and itslength_[x,y,z]description is inaccurate forgeometry = 2, where those extents are ignored. Please update the Particle Clouds section accordingly.
